23 April 1995
World Book and Copyright Day is a UNESCO initiative first held in 1995.By celebrating this Day throughout the world, UNESCO seeks to promote reading, publishing and the protection of intellectual property through copyright. The date was especially chosen because it is accepted as Shakespeare’s birthday and coincidentally, several well-known writers either died or were born on the day. Activities on the day include relay reading, the distribution of bookmarks and announcements of writing competitions. The activities are jointly organized by writers, publishers, NGO’s, public and private institutions and the media. The South African theme for 2013 World Book Day is: “In Books I find”¦”
